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Enable TLS for image-cache webserver #56

Merged
merged 3 commits into from
Jun 25, 2024
Merged

Conversation

hardys
Copy link
Contributor

@hardys hardys commented Jun 6, 2024

This means we can use https for the image references from the BMH

Note this will require suse-edge/charts#130

This means we can use https for the image references from the BMH

Note this will require suse-edge/charts#130
This previously seemed to work, but with the latest Leap Micro build
there are python dependency issues, so instead only run the the
hypervisor host and copy the kubeconfig via ssh
Use the latest released version, intead of main
@hardys hardys marked this pull request as ready for review June 21, 2024 14:06
@hardys
Copy link
Contributor Author

hardys commented Jun 21, 2024

This is now ready for review - I had to make a couple of additional changes due to updates in upstream LeapMicro and local-path-provisioner dependencies

Copy link
Contributor

@alknopfler alknopfler left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I added a comment just to confirm the versión but anyway LGTM

@@ -1,7 +1,9 @@
---
metal3_repo_url: https://github.com/suse-edge/charts.git
metal3_branch: main
metal3_chart_version: 0.6.5

metal3_chart_version: 0.7.2
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I guess this is include also the reprovisioning patch at the same time, right? But I'm wondering if we can make it already available.

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yes I aligned with the latest upstream version ref suse-edge/charts#133 even though the downstream release of this is still pending

@hardys hardys changed the title [WIP] Enable TLS for image-cache webserver Enable TLS for image-cache webserver Jun 24, 2024
@hardys hardys merged commit d23bf7c into suse-edge:main Jun 25,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ants